INC non-committal on reported Duterte-Marcos endorsement

Philstar.com

MANILA, Philippines — The influential Iglesia ni Cristo was non-committal on Thursday morning despite reports that the church has already endorsed Davao City Mayor Rodrigo Duterte and Sen. Ferdinand Marcos Jr. in the May 9 elections.

In a text message to Philstar.com, Iglesia ni Cristo spokesperson Ka Edwil Zabala declined to confirm that members had already been told in worship services that the church has picked candidates it will support.

"Wala pa rin naman na nababago sa sinabi ko sa mga taga-press/media na nagtanong. Kapag nasabi na namin sa mga kapatid namin sa Iglesia kung sino ang napagakaisahang iboto ng INC ay malalaman din ninyo," he said.

Zabala sent a similar reply Wednesday when asked about the supposed endorsement and about reports that a sample ballot including the names of Duterte and Marcos had been distributed to members of the church. Duterte is running for president under PDP-Laban while Marcos, a member of the Nacionalista Party, is running for vice president.

According to a newspaper report, the announcement of the endorsement was made in a circular read at a worship service on Wednesday night by executive minister Eduardo Manalo.

Asked about reports that he has been endorsed by the native church, Duterte said he is not privy to the information.

"'Di ko po talaga alam," Duterte said at a roundtable discussion with STAR editors. — with reports by Rosette Adel and Jonathan de Santos
